Imbaga
Imbaga is a hamlet in Carmen, Bohol, Central Visayas, Davao Region. Imbaga is situated nearby to the village Monte Video, as well as near La Salvacion.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Batuan, officially the Municipality of Batuan, is a municipality in the province of Bohol, Philippines. According to the 2020 census, it has a population of 13,845 people. Batuan is situated 7 km west of Imbaga.

Sierra Bullones, officially the Municipality of Sierra Bullones, is a municipality in the province of Bohol, Philippines. According to the 2020 census, it has a population of 26,095 people. Sierra Bullones is situated 9 km east of Imbaga.
